Answer: From the provided case study, it has been observed that the rate of inflation needs to be taken into account for the revenues and expenses, which move in tandem with the CPI and personnel expenses. This has been agreed with the agreement of general wages (Andrs et al.). The inflation rate in Spain is 3%, while that in USA is 1.5%. In extreme situations, the government might tend to increase the supply of money for repaying its debt. However, this situation is unlikely to occur in Spain, as the nation has a strong economy. Since the revenue margin of Real Madrid has increased from 137,909 in 2000-01 to 236,001 in 2003-04, it is likely that Real Madrid has the ability to bear the rising rate of inflation in maintaining its club operations. Therefore, the strong fiscal and monetary policies of Spain would help Real Madrid to curb the negative effects of inflation. Rate of interest: Another uncertainty relating to financial budget is the interest rate, which is 2.5% per year in terms of EURIBOR. A rise in the interest rate would minimise the revenue margin of Real Madrid and vice-versa. Any appreciation in cross-border interest rate might decrease revenue and increase expenses for Real Madrid. Similarly, a fall in the cross-border interest rate would increase the revenue margin, as acquisition of foreign players could be made at a cheaper cost. In addition, the transfer fees to acquire players would be low, if the Euro value appreciates with respect to USD and vice-versa. However, the above-mentioned uncertainties could be minimised through hedging strategies and provisions. With the help of hedging, the adverse price movements of a security could be minimised (Baena). In addition, the club needs to create an amount of provision that could be used to sign star players, when the Euro currency falls in the global market. Rate of exchange: From the provided case study, it has been observed that the value of Euro is obtained as $1.18, 1.55 CHF and 0.68. This depicts that Real Madrid could acquire or sign players from the provinces of USA and other UEFA countries. However, Real Madrid might need to pay additional amount, if it decides to purchase players from the province of UK due to the weak Euro value with respect to pound. Therefore, separate provisions of funds by collecting amounts from the sponsors could help in minimising the negative impact of the exchange rate on Real Madrid. Real Madrid is a non-profit organisation and therefore, the revenue generation of the club varies based on the ticket sales and sponsorships. It has been identified from the case study that the club uses a balanced scorecard approach as the financial perspective. In order to ensure the interests of the shareholders, the club has optimised its costs by limiting the number of players. The profitability has been optimised through player investments, which has helped in maximisation of revenues (Barajas and Plcido). Since Real Madrid has been involved in cost optimisation, the monthly salary of the players might be reduced. In case, the salaries of the star players are reduced, it might result in loss of motivation level. The same applies for the sports staffs and the other associated members of the club as well. As a result, it might degrade the operational efficiency of the club and lower productivity level. In addition, the reduction in number of staffs could decrease the team competitiveness, as the existing members might fear of losing their jobs. Thus, from the competitive point of view, the cost optimisation strategy might have negative impact on the staff productivity of Real Madrid. In the words of Craven, accelerated depreciation system is used to minimise the costs through increased deductions taken during the beginning year of operation. However, its lower future deduction could pose serious complexities to Real Madrid. This is because it only boosts up the realisation of deductions; however, it does not provide greater tax deductions. Since Real Madrid has not put the transfer of the star players in the income statement line, it would have lesser alternatives to minimise its tax bracket and therefore, the net income could be minimised. Under the system of accelerated depreciation, an asset loses its book value at a quicker rate in contrast to the conventional straight-line method of depreciation. Ocean Lab Report Paper We went to Cortex Madder Salt Marsh, which is located 12 miles North of San Francisco, to examine how rising and falling of tide effect on water level in the marsh and channel. My hypothesis is tide and water level of marsh and channel has positive relationship. The rising tide may raise the water level of marsh and falling tide make water level of marsh decrease. Therefore, since our experiment was limited in few hours, the water level of marsh will be changed (up or down) in few centimeters. The location map M-1) and study area map (M-2) will be attached on next page. Methods To measure and compare the water level of marsh and channel, the class moved along the levy and placed meter sticks into marsh (B) and opposing channel (A). We had four locations for variable: The T (1), Caution Sign (2), Merits Bench (3), and the Point (4). Since the meter sticks were not exactly placed to set O as the begging of change, the 0 was adjusted depend on the location. The experiment location started with 1 to 4 and came back from 4 to 1. Therefore, each location as different elapsed time. For example, site 4 (The Point) has shortest time because we put meter sticks and took off without any moving location. Result Our data has two tables because it contains data from two classes. First data is from Wednesday 19th (T-1), which is our class and the other data is from Thursday class (T-2), 20th of July. The location and the experiment time period are same for both data tables. The Tables are attached on following page. The result of T-1 and T-2 is different. T-1 does not have any significant change in eater level the greatest change was -CM/h at AAA. Discussion To confirm my assumption, which is each day has different tide cycle, I compare our data to Cortex Madder tide table. On Wednesday 19th, Cortex Madder Creek has first low tide at 3:37 AM and second low tide at 2:57 pm. The first high tide was at 10:05 am and the next high tide was at 9:22 pm. The tidal coefficient was 67 (middle). The maximum high tide recorded in the tide tables for Cortex Madder Creek which is of 7. 2 Ft and a minimum height of -2. 0 Ft. Therefore, during experiment (2:39 pm first in and 4:01 pm last out), we had second low tide after e put meter stick on B but before AAA. Then, the graph shows that the tide started to rise slowly during rest of period. B (2:40 4:01 pm), AAA pm) and B(3:13-3:38 pm) have positive velocity responding to the tide table. On Thursday, 20th of June, the first low tide was at 4:28 am and the next low tide at 3:54 pm. The first high tide was at 11:12 am and the next high tide was at 10:10 pm. The tidal coefficient was 77 (high). The maximum high tide is of 7. 2 Ft and a minimum height of -2. 0 Ft. The fist time in of meter stick was 2:33 pm and the last mime out of meter stick was 3:57 pm on Thursday.

The American Dream In The Great Gatsby, F. Scott Fitzgerald uses many repeated references to time in order to draw attention to the so-called American Dream, which is something Jay Gatsby sorely desires in this novel. Time is the most important motif in The Great Gatsby, the word itself appears 87 times! Gatsby is constantly striving to get back to that perfect moment in time is to recapture Daisy's heart. These time references are expressed through all the literary techniques. Some episodes which symbolize time are when Gatsby knocks over the clock and his list of famous party guests written on a timetable. Time itself is a dissolution, and therefore symbolizes the irony of the American Dream, another dissolution. As time passes, Gatsby and his aspirations for realizing this Dream seem to drift farther and farther apart. Others in the novel are striving for this patriotic goal as well. Myrtle (who's name is a noxious weed vine, that strives to climb) thinks she can find it through love; love of Tom Buchanan's money. The yellow-gold car that killed her (gold representing riches) is really her passion for all things materialistic shattering her dream. George Wilson, probably the most honest character in the book, also thinks the answer to finding the dream is love, but real love; for Myrtle, and himself. When he thinks Gatsby has killed his love, he kills him and then himself, knowing that his version of the dream is unattainable. The two people who truly appear to live the dream are Tom and Daisy. But they cheat on each other and have no love for one another. What kind of dream is that? Jay Gatsby threw extravagant parties in order to see Daisy, who never showed (But, then again neither did he). He peered out of his mansion, a mere copy of grandeur, and watched other dreamers pass their time.And as for time, the novel begins with the phrase: In my younger and more vulnerable years... and ends with ...borne bck ceaselessly into the past. Both emphasize the ignificance of time. The only compliment Nick ever pays tsby shows how the American Dream is not so valid in theGreat Gatsby. As Nick is leaving Gatsby's house, he shoutsfrom the lawn,They're a rotten crowd....you're worth thewhole bunch put together. l in all, time has eroded all these characters' perception of the American Dream.
